What Is Car Hire Insurance Excess?
The insurance excess is the maximum amount you would be liable for in the event of your rental vehicle being damaged. The excess amount of a vehicle depends upon the supplier and the type of vehicle you want to hire. Please ask one of our agents for more details. It can generally vary from between £500.00 to £3000.00 depending on what category of vehicle you require.
Can I reduce my excess?
You can cover yourself in relation to getting coverage for you excess and liability on the hire vehicle/ You have two options for this; Excess Reduction and Excess Reimbursement.
What is the difference between excess reduction and excess reimbursement?
Excess reduction reduces your excess down to a certain amount and means your reduce your liability. Excess reimbursement means you still have an excess and have to pay in the event of the vehicle being damaged, however you are reimbursed for this through the policy.
What is excess reduction?
Excess reduction is taken out directly with a supplier and means that you reduce your maximum liability down to a certain amount. This generally costs between £10.00 and £30.00 per day depending on the supplier and vehicle selected.
What is excess reimbursement?
Excess reimbursement means you still have an excess on a vehicle, however in the event of the vehicle being damaged, you would pay the supplier the estimated costs to repair the vehicle, and be reimbursed fully for the costs by making a claim with one of our team.
